VTR flow-meters can be installed even under the harshest application conditions in the oil, petrochemical and the, chemical industries as well as in other industry sectors. The range of nominal widths spans from 10mm to 500mm for the flanged version and from 10mm to 50mm for the version with threaded connection. All flowmeters in the VTR series are individually calibrated. A wide selection of electronic processing and indicator units are available. Functioning Principle Basically, the VTR consists of a rotor, the housing and the measurement pick-up. The flow of fluid sets the rotor in to motion. When the rotor blades interrupt the magnetic field lines of the pick-p, the motion of the rotor is detected. Because of the specific inner diameter, the turbine's revolutions are directly proportional to the flow. The turbine revolution is detected using an external sensor. The output signal is a flow-proportional frequency(pulse form). Further processing of the signal can follow using a separate processing and indicator unit.
